Hi all, Can somebody suggest one example of how SCTP determines that a congestion has been encountered in the receiving direction? Once SCTP does find congestion condition and communicates the same to M2PA, & hence, sends Link Status Busy message to the peer, it is specified (RFC4615, sec 4.1.5) that the peer shall start Timer T6. Before T6 expires, the initiating node’s SCTP must send (& keep doing so periodically) another "Link Status Busy" message. It appears that unlike in MTP2, no timer like T7 is to be kept active at the peer when M2PA is being used, & therefore, AS LONG AS (as many times as it does) initiating end keeps sending Link Status Busy messages WITHIN T6 expiry, the LINK (in other word – the SCTP Association) shall NEVER be forced “out of service”. Is this understanding correct? Is there any situation specified when the peer is NOT supposed to even start timer T6? Independent of all this, when the RFC4615 says (in section 4.1.5) that “ . . . . . . . . T7 SHALL expire”, WHAT IS THE NEXT STEP AFTER T7 expires?? Is it that the link shall be considered OOS (or, for that matter, would steps be initiated to put the link OOS?)
